PER CURIAM.

William Sullivan, as personal representative of the estate of Guillermo Hernandez, appeals from a final summary judgment entered in favor of the decedent's employer, defendant, Dry Lake Dairy, Inc. on a spoliation of evidence claim. We affirm.
